Transaction 74f79e68f9fb8ef99d954606bd9d04f04389114b7b37437c230955555215deee
1 Input
1 Output
-
74f79e68f9fb8ef99d954606bd9d04f04389114b7b37437c230955555215deee:0
- value
- 20831641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c6cf0f31b8e964ab14bf1d4a8136ac3f7816fb5 OP_EQUAL
- address
- 37CWyRQEfvLAw7VhBsg3oiv9tLZjsbUWLt